David Lakhdhir Publishes Article on Implications of the EU’s Due Diligence Directive for U.S. Companies in Business Law Today

July 15, 2024

Corporate partner David Lakhdhir wrote an article for the American Bar Association’s Business Law Today on the European Union’s recently-published Corporate Sustainability Due Diligence Directive (CSDDD) and how it will significantly impact large companies operating in the EU, including nearly all large U.S. multinational enterprises. In the article, “The EU Due Diligence Directive: Implications for U.S. Companies,” published on July 15, David provides an in-depth overview of the directive, which converts previously non-binding UN and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development guidelines into legally enforceable obligations, covering areas such as workers' rights, climate change, environmental protection and human rights. Key compliance challenges for corporations include ensuring fair wages globally, protecting workers' rights in countries with differing laws, and balancing business operations with stringent environmental standards.

David notes that U.S. companies will want to assess the potential impact of the directive on their global operations, closely follow further developments as the CSDDD is transposed into national laws and prepare to become compliant before these new requirements start to become effective in 2027.
